How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 20191?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 20191 Studio Apartments | $2,413 | $1,618 | $5,507 |
| 20191 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,735 | $1,795 | $8,299 |
| 20191 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,793 | $1,913 | $8,857 |
| 20191 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,543 | $2,148 | $16,471 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 20191 ZIP Code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in 20191?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in 20191 with Washer/Dryer is at Kings Gate West listed at $1,555.
How much is the average rent for 20191 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in 20191 with Washer/Dryer is $1,727.
What is the largest 20191 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in 20191 is a 2,297 square feet unit starting from $1,555 at Kings Gate West.
What is the average size for 20191 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in 20191 is currently at 868 sq ft.
